全面覆盖MySQL、Oracle、DB2的Kettle数据库驱动包
下载需积分: 49 | ZIP格式 | 6.71MB |
更新于2025-03-18
| 44 浏览量 | 举报
标题“kettle数据库驱动包.zip”指的是一个压缩文件,该文件的命名意味着它是一个数据库驱动程序的集合,专门为Kettle工具所用。Kettle是一个开源的ETL(Extract, Transform, Load)工具,通常用于数据仓库项目。这个“kettle数据库驱动包.zip”文件中包含针对特定数据库系统所必需的驱动程序,使得Kettle能够与不同的数据库系统进行交互和数据操作。
描述中提到的“包含mysql,oracle,DB2”揭示了该驱动包包含的数据库驱动种类,涵盖了三种流行的关系型数据库管理系统(RDBMS),即MySQL、Oracle和IBM DB2。这些驱动是必须的,因为Kettle在执行数据抽取、转换和加载操作时需要能够访问和操作这些数据库系统中的数据。每个数据库系统都有自己的接口和协议,因此需要相应的驱动程序来支持Kettle与之通信。
标签“驱动程序”进一步强调了该压缩文件的用途,即作为数据库连接的接口。在软件开发和数据集成中,驱动程序是使应用程序能够与硬件或软件资源交互的一种中间软件。对于数据库而言,驱动程序是实现数据库操作的关键组件,它允许应用程序,比如Kettle,在不同类型的数据库之间发送查询和命令。
压缩包文件的文件名称列表中仅给出了“kettle数据库驱动包”,这表明压缩包内应包含多个子文件,而每个子文件都是针对特定数据库系统设计的驱动程序。例如,可能会有类似“mysql-connector-java-x.x.x-bin.jar”这样的文件,用于MySQL数据库,其中“x.x.x”代表版本号。对于Oracle和DB2同样会存在相应的驱动程序文件。这些文件通常是以JAR(Java Archive)文件格式存储的,因为Kettle是用Java编写的,而JAR文件则是Java平台上的打包和部署格式。
在使用这个数据库驱动包之前,需要先了解Kettle(也称为Pentaho Data Integration或PDI)与这些数据库驱动的安装和配置方式。安装过程中,需要确保相关的驱动程序文件被放置在Kettle的类路径(classpath)中,这样Kettle在启动时能够识别并加载这些驱动,以便执行数据库操作。如果驱动程序没有正确加载,Kettle将无法与指定的数据库系统通信,导致数据集成任务失败。
使用数据库驱动包时,还需要考虑数据库连接的配置参数,如主机地址、端口号、数据库名称、用户名和密码等。这些信息需要在Kettle的转换或作业中设置,以确保能够成功建立与数据库的连接。
此外,随着数据库管理系统的更新和升级,驱动程序也会相应地更新。因此,开发者在使用数据库驱动包时,还需确保所用的驱动程序版本与所连接的数据库系统版本兼容。不匹配的版本可能会导致功能缺失、性能下降或者直接的连接错误。
总结以上内容,该“kettle数据库驱动包.zip”文件是开发者在进行数据集成时,为了确保Kettle能与不同数据库系统交互而需要的关键资源。文件中包含的驱动程序是针对MySQL、Oracle和DB2这三个数据库系统的,它们是实现Kettle与数据库系统通信的中间件。正确地配置和使用这些驱动程序是确保数据处理流程顺畅和数据集成任务成功的重要前提。在实际操作中,还必须注意数据库版本与驱动程序版本的兼容性问题,以避免因版本不匹配导致的连接或执行失败。
相关推荐









菜鸟程序员也有梦想
- 粉丝: 54
最新资源
- Python库payler-0.2.0:下载与安装指南
- C++算法实现查找并排序最小素数
- memcacheclient-2.0发布:修复关键Bug的跨平台C++客户端源码
- USB转232串口驱动安装与使用指南
- VS2005源码案例学习与初学者指导
- 八方汇PLC通讯调试神器:工控自动化软件新选择
- 超酷CSS3图片遮罩层动画效果
- 深入学习PHP与jQuery开发技巧与实战源码解析
- Windows下ADB日志抓取工具使用指南
- 深入浅出Maven项目管理与JavaScript应用
- Web前端初级模拟试题二及答案解析
- Bootstrap v3.3.5 中文API文档CHM版
- Apkok-v2.3:Android软件上传工具的使用指南
- Altium Designer STM32元件库完整下载指南
- 自动化安装Flash Player补丁工具解析
- 挑战 Boss-Level-Challenge-3 的 JavaScript 解决方案